E-Bikes
E-bikes have become a favored form of transport across the globe. They are a less expensive and sustainable alternative to cars and scooters. They are ideal for short or long distances, and offer an excellent exercise. E-bikes come with a tiny electric motor that acts as a pedal assist, only providing energy when the rider is pedaling. This allows riders to obtain some of the health benefits that come with regular cycling and reduce personal barriers to commuter biking.
The battery of an e-bike performs several important functions. It powers the motor, the bike's display, and sensors. It allows the rider to personalize their riding experience. It can be used to select support mode, track ride information and even update firmware. Some e-bikes come with a second battery that can be attached to the frame for additional range.
Many e-bikes have the ability to ride them at speeds up to 20 miles per hour. This is an excellent option for those who don't wish to sweat, or who need to travel farther than regular bikes can accommodate.
E-bikes can be used on a variety of terrain, but they are best suited for urban areas. They are perfect for commuters who want to avoid traffic and save time. E-bikes can be an excellent alternative for those who do not want to keep a car or pay parking fees.

E-Skateboards
Electric skateboards are a fantastic option to experience the thrill and freedom of skating without the hassle of the traffic or bus schedules. They're a green and fun alternative to motorbikes or cars and can even get you to places that you might not be able to access on the foot. The most well-known type of E-Skateboard is the longboard, which is ideal for city cruising and can travel at speeds up to 20 miles per hour.

E-Swegways
The Segway is an electronic self-balancing vehicle that was first launched in 1999. It was invented by Dean Kamen, who envisioned the device as a novel way to travel around town. Its first public appearance was on Good Morning America, where the hosts tried it out and were extremely impressed by it. The vehicles were initially an option for companies such as FedEx, Amazon and others. However, the device was unable to gain traction and only 140,000 units were sold.
Although the Segway was a fantastic invention, it couldn't replace bikes or cars. The price of $5,000 made it expensive for most people to see the Segway as an alternative form of transportation. Furthermore the design of the vehicle wasn't innovative or elegant. It didn't catch the attention of the public.
It is crucial to realize, however, that even although the Segway was a complete failure, its invention did pave the way for future developments of personal vehicles. Segway's gyroscopic system, for example, made it possible for smooth and stable movement. It also led to a new generation of electronic transporters that use lithium batteries, which have better energy density and power-to mass ratios than traditional lead-acid batteries or NiMH batteries.
Segway's gyroscopes can monitor the user's movements and transmit this information to motors that control the wheels. These motors are powered by a central board that acts as the vehicle’s brain. This system of coordination and communication can be compared to workings of the inner ear as well as the brain and the muscular system.
Additionally, the Segway's electric propulsion system means that it produces zero emissions during its operation, making it a more eco-friendly alternative to gasoline powered transportation. Its compact size and ability to negotiate tight turns also make it a more efficient alternative to automobiles for short-distance urban transportation.
